Class action is a legal procedure that allows a group of people with similar claims to come together and file a lawsuit as a collective group. In Albania, class action is governed by the Law on Class Actions, which sets out the procedures and requirements for initiating and participating in a class action lawsuit.
You may need a lawyer for class action in Albania if you believe you have been harmed by the actions of a company or organization, and you want to seek compensation on behalf of yourself and others who have been similarly affected. A lawyer can help you navigate the complex legal process, gather evidence, and represent your interests in court.
In Albania, class action lawsuits can be brought for a wide range of consumer protection, competition law, environmental protection, and other legal violations. The Law on Class Actions sets out the criteria for certification of a class, the appointment of a representative plaintiff, and the distribution of any damages awarded.
A class action lawsuit is a legal procedure that allows a group of people with similar claims to bring a lawsuit as a collective group.
To qualify as a member of a class action lawsuit in Albania, you must meet the criteria set out in the Law on Class Actions, which typically include being affected by the same legal violation as other members of the class.
Class action lawsuits in Albania can be brought for a wide range of legal violations, including consumer protection, competition law, and environmental protection.
The duration of a class action lawsuit in Albania can vary depending on the complexity of the case and the court's schedule. It is advisable to consult with a lawyer to get a better idea of the timeline for your specific case.
Many lawyers who handle class action cases in Albania work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if the case is successful and the plaintiffs receive compensation.
If the class action lawsuit is successful in Albania, the court may order the defendant to pay damages to the class members. The distribution of damages will be determined by the court based on the evidence presented in the case.
In Albania, class members typically have the option to opt out of a class action lawsuit if they wish to pursue their own individual claims separately from the class.
Joining a class action lawsuit in Albania can allow you to pursue a legal claim that might otherwise be too costly or time-consuming to pursue individually. It also allows you to benefit from the expertise of lawyers who specialize in class action cases.
While the rules for class action lawsuits may vary by jurisdiction, in general, you may be able to join a class action lawsuit in Albania if you have been affected by the legal violation at issue in the case.
